Fleuchlarg Hill
Fleuchlarg Hill is a peak in Dumfries and Galloway, South West, Scotland and has an elevation of 928 feet. Fleuchlarg Hill is situated nearby to the hamlet Wallaceton, as well as near Brockhillstone.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Closeburn
Village

Closeburn is a village and civil parish in Dumfries and Galloway, Scotland. The village is on the A76 road 2+1⁄2 miles south of Thornhill. In the 2001 census, Closeburn had a population of 1,119.
Penpont
Village

Penpont is a village about 2 miles west of Thornhill in Dumfriesshire, in the Dumfries and Galloway region of Scotland. It is near the confluence of the Shinnel Water and Scaur Water rivers in the foothills of the Southern Uplands.

Tynron is a village and civil parish located in Dumfries and Galloway, in south-west Scotland. It lies in a hollow along the Shinnel Water, approximately 2 miles from the village of Moniaive.
